The amount of heat needed to raise the temperature of 10kg of Copper by 1K is its
specific heat capacity
latent heat
heat capacity
internal energy
Correct answer is C
The heat capacity of a defined system is the amount of heat (usually expressed in calories, kilocalories, or joules) needed to raise the system's temperature by one degree (usually expressed in Celsius or Kelvin).
